I would probably pick the Asus U56E-BAL7. The price is reasonable (List $630), it has a 15.6" display, 6gb RAM, 750gb storage, excellent portability, 9-hour battery life, features very good ergonomics, performance, and versatility, and weighs only 5.7lb. It is one of the models recommended by Consumer Reports (August 2012). I don't play video games, so I don't need a high video memory feature.
